Our Story
The name Kora comes from a Tibetan Buddhist practice of circumambulation, a meditative act of walking around a sacred object. The practice itself becomes a form of reflection, a return inward.
Inspired by this ritual, Kora represents circling back to oneself through intentional movement, breath, and presence.
